📚 What is a Compound?
A compound is a substance formed when two or more chemical elements are chemically bonded together. This means the atoms share or exchange electrons to form a stable connection.
- ⚛️Definition: A substance consisting of two or more different elements chemically bonded together in a fixed ratio.
- 🤝Bonding: Elements are joined through chemical bonds, such as covalent or ionic bonds.
- 🧮Fixed Ratio: The elements in a compound always combine in the same proportions by mass. For example, water ($H_2O$) always has two hydrogen atoms for every one oxygen atom.
📜 A Little History
Understanding compounds has evolved over centuries. Early alchemists laid the groundwork, but it was scientists like Antoine Lavoisier in the 18th century who began to define elements and compounds more clearly through quantitative experiments. The development of atomic theory by John Dalton in the early 19th century further refined our understanding, explaining how atoms combine in fixed ratios to form compounds.
🔑 Key Principles for Identifying Compounds
Identifying compounds involves understanding their chemical formulas, properties, and how they react with other substances.
- 🧪Chemical Formula: Know how to read chemical formulas like $H_2O$ (water) or $CO_2$ (carbon dioxide). The subscripts indicate the number of atoms of each element in the compound.
- 🌡️Physical Properties: Observe physical properties such as melting point, boiling point, density, and color. These properties are constant for a pure compound.
- 🔥Chemical Reactions: Compounds undergo chemical reactions to form new substances. For example, acids react with bases to form salts and water.
- 🔍Decomposition: Some compounds can be broken down into simpler substances through processes like heating (thermal decomposition) or electrolysis (using electricity).
- 💧Solubility: Observe whether a substance dissolves in water or other solvents. Different compounds have different solubilities.
🌍 Real-World Examples of Compounds
Compounds are everywhere! Here are a few examples you encounter every day:
- 💧Water ($H_2O$): Essential for life, used as a solvent, and found in rivers, lakes, and oceans.
- 🧂Sodium Chloride ($NaCl$): Common table salt, used for seasoning and preserving food.
- 💨Carbon Dioxide ($CO_2$): A greenhouse gas, used in carbonated drinks and produced during respiration.
- 🍬Glucose ($C_6H_{12}O_6$): A simple sugar, a source of energy for living organisms.
- 🧪Ammonia ($NH_3$): Used in fertilizers and cleaning products.
